Ingredients
10 - 12

Ingredients

  • Wheat flour
  • Gram flour
  • Rice flour
  • Spinach
  • Onion
  • Cumin
  • Red chilli powder
  • Turmeric powder
  • Cumin powder
  • Oil
  • Salt
  • Water

Instructions

  • add all the ingredients into a bowl and slowly star mixing by adding lukewarm water. Knead it to a wet dough but not sticky. Cover with a damp cloth and rest for about 10 minutes. Now to prepare the Thalipeeth, place a non stick tawa/ on the heat. Spread out a large piece of plastic cover on your work surface. Grease your palms with oil. Take a portion of dough and place it in the centre of the parchment or plastic Then gently flatten it out to form a hand-patted disc. Lift the paper, along with the roti on it and turning it over, place it on the skillet with the rotti down on the hot skillet. Drizzle a little bit of oil along the edges of the roti and in the centre, into the hole made on the roti and allow it to sizzle and crisp up. When it seems half cooked, flip the roti over with a spatula to cook the other side. Cook well till you have brown patches on both sides. Then, take the thalipeeth off the skillet, add a dollop of butter or ghee, and serve immediately.
